| Note | |
description: Himerometra with enlarged proximal pinnules of 30-32 segments chiefly broader than long; very stout basally, gradually tapering to a delicate flagellate tip; distal edges of at least middle segments strongly produced, everted and smooth; all segments of proximal pinnules and proximal segments of following pinnules never carinate. Cirri stouter than in other Himerometra species, 25-30 mm long, of 25-30 cirrals; distalmost 10-12 cirrals with a low dorsal tubercle. Arms 41-51, 140 mm long. [details]
